Furthermore, understanding the nuances of property as an investment asset is crucial. Factors such as rental yields, potential for capital appreciation, and liquidity need to be evaluated.
For investors, the choice between ready-to-move-in properties and under-construction projects also presents different risk-reward profiles. While ready properties offer immediate returns and certainty, under-construction projects can offer a lower entry point and higher appreciation potential upon completion. Legal Frameworks and Compliance in Indian Real Estate
The legal landscape governing real estate in India has undergone significant reforms to enhance transparency and protect consumer interests. The Real Estate (Regulation and Development) Act, 2016 (RERA), stands as a landmark legislation. Understanding and adhering to RERA guidelines is vital for both buyers and developers.
For instance, in Gurugram, all real estate projects exceeding a certain size must be registered with the Haryana Real Estate Regulatory Authority. This ensures timely project completion, adherence to promised specifications, and provides a robust grievance redressal mechanism for buyers. Beyond RERA, other legal aspects such as stamp duty, registration fees, property taxes, and the process of property mutation are critical. These vary by state and property type, making expert guidance invaluable. Distinguishing Between Residential and Commercial Investments
Property ownership isn't a monolithic concept; it branches into distinct categories, primarily residential and commercial, each with unique characteristics, benefits, and challenges. Understanding these differences is crucial for aligning your investment with your financial goals.
| Feature | Residential Property | Commercial Property |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Use | Living, dwelling | Business operations, offices, retail, industrial |
| Tenant Profile | Individuals, families | Businesses, corporations, retail chains |
| Lease Period | Typically 11 months, renewable | Longer, often 3-9 years, with lock-in periods |
| Rental Yield Potential | Generally 2-4% | Higher, often 6-10% or more, depending on location and type |
| Capital Appreciation | Steady, influenced by social infrastructure | Can be rapid, influenced by economic growth and business demand |
| Maintenance Costs | Lower, often borne by owner/RWA | Higher, often passed to tenant (CAM charges) |
| Financing Options | Easier availability of home loans | Specific commercial property loans, often with higher interest rates |
We've observed that while residential properties offer emotional value and tend to be more liquid, commercial properties can provide higher rental income and stronger capital appreciation, especially in high-growth areas. The choice depends on an individual's investment horizon, risk tolerance, and cash flow requirements. Our portfolio includes a diverse range of properties designed to meet varied investor profiles.
